Abstract

Refractive index measurements have been carried out on xenon liquid and vapour in coexistence from -59.0°c to 16.5°c, and also on fluid xenon at temperatures above the critical point (16.59°c). The results of over 500 measurements indicate that the Lorentz-Lorenz function (n2-1)/(n2+2)ρ remains constant to within ±3% over the whole density range studied (0.001 to 0.02 mol cm-3) and that at the critical point nc = 1.3799±0.0008 and LLc = 10.5±0.1 cm3 mol-1 (λ = 5893 Angstrom).
